Learn how to do a bucket test to check if your pool water level is dropping due to evaporation or a leak By comparing water levels inside a bucket placed on pool steps with the pool’s water level over 24 hours, pool owners can detect leaks early Find out how to isolate the leak to the liner or the equipment and lines with two more tests.
